The E-Commerce Explosion and the Erosion of Trust
The dramatic increase in product recalls is inextricably linked to the explosive growth of e-commerce, particularly through platforms like AliExpress, Temu, and Shein. While offering unprecedented access to affordable goods, these platforms often operate with limited oversight of their vast network of suppliers. The sheer volume of products, coupled with complex supply chains, makes traditional inspection methods inadequate. **Product safety** is no longer simply a matter of border control; it’s a data challenge.
The Role of Counterfeit Components and Supply Chain Opacity
A significant portion of the recalled products aren’t outright fakes, but contain substandard or dangerous components. This is particularly concerning in sectors like electronics, toys, and personal care items. The opacity of global supply chains allows unscrupulous manufacturers to substitute cheaper, potentially harmful materials without detection. Tracing the origin of these components is often impossible, leaving consumers vulnerable.

AI-Powered Risk Assessment and Predictive Analytics
AI can analyze vast datasets – including product descriptions, supplier information, and consumer reviews – to identify high-risk products *before* they reach consumers. Machine learning algorithms can flag anomalies and predict potential safety issues based on patterns and correlations that would be impossible for humans to detect. This allows regulators to focus their resources on the most problematic products and suppliers.
Blockchain for Supply Chain Transparency
Blockchain technology offers a secure and immutable record of a product’s journey from origin to consumer. By recording each step of the supply chain – from raw material sourcing to manufacturing, packaging, and shipping – blockchain creates a transparent and auditable trail. This makes it significantly harder for counterfeiters to introduce substandard components and allows consumers to verify the authenticity of products.

What are the biggest risks associated with unsafe imported products?
The risks range from minor injuries to serious health problems, even death. Common hazards include toxic chemicals, electrical malfunctions, choking hazards, and flammable materials. Children and vulnerable populations are particularly at risk.
How can consumers protect themselves from unsafe products?
Be wary of unusually low prices, especially on unfamiliar platforms. Read product reviews carefully, and look for certifications from reputable organizations. Report any suspected unsafe products to your local consumer protection agency.
Will blockchain technology make all products completely safe?
Blockchain enhances transparency and traceability, making it harder to introduce counterfeit or substandard components. However, it’s not a silver bullet. It relies on accurate data input at each stage of the supply chain and requires widespread adoption to be truly effective.
What role do e-commerce platforms play in ensuring product safety?
E-commerce platforms have a responsibility to vet their suppliers and monitor product listings for safety concerns. They should invest in AI-powered risk assessment tools and collaborate with regulators to enforce safety standards.
